Archaeologists Discover Continueses To Be of Two Additional Preys at Pompeii

.Excavators just recently found out the continueses to be of pair of added victims at Pompeii, the ancient area near Naples that was actually stashed during a catastrophic explosion of the nearby Mount Vesuvius.
On August 12, the Archaeological Park of Pompeii revealed that the skeletal systems of a man and woman along with a tiny store of prize had been located inside a short-term room in the course of the improvement of the home. "The girl was discovered on the mattress and also was holding a small cache of jewel along with gold, silver and bronze pieces, and some jewelry including a set of gold and also gem jewelry," a push claim mentioned. The male lay at the foot of the mattress.

Depending on to an article posted in the archaeological playground's digital diary, the man and woman were actually trapped inside the small room after pumice filled the adjacent locations of your home, blocking their capacity to open up a door and escape the situation.
The guy and also girl died due to being actually stashed by warm fuel as well as volcanic issue, likewise called pyroclastic flow. The outbreak of Mount Vesuvius in 79 CE eliminated countless Romans after the urban area was actually completely covered in a thick layer of ash, which maintained most of Pompeii's homeowners as well as its buildings.
The park additionally claimed the excavators had the capacity to restore the home's furniture as well as their precise positions during the time of the mountain's eruption. The study group was able to do this by recognizing the perceptions of the things left in the ash by decomposed raw material as well as casting deep spaces. These products consisted of a timber mattress, a feces, a chest, and also a table along with a marble best, which stored bronze, glass and ceramic things. The feelings likewise showed a sizable bronze branched candlestick owner had likewise tipped over in the room." The opportunity to evaluate the very useful anthropological records associating with the two victims found within the archaeological context that denoted their heartbreaking point, permits our team to bounce back a sizable amount of details about the life of the early Pompeiians and the micro-histories of some of all of them, along with specific and also prompt documents, affirming the individuality of the Vesuvian region," playground supervisor Gabriel Zuchtriegel pointed out in a declaration.
Zuchtriegel also said he assumed "considerable advancements" through historical diggings in the happening years as a result of expenditures recently announced by Gennaro Sangiuliano, the nation's society pastor.
